Meals-on-WheelsBasilica volunteers partner with Meals-on-Wheels to bring meals to residents of the Loring Park area of downtown who are not able to prepare a meal for themselves. Higher Ground Shelter MealBasilica volunteers cook and serve a hot meal for 200 people six evenings each month at Higher Ground, a downtown Minneapolis shelter for men. Sandwich MinistryEach day the rectory is open, sandwiches and coffee are offered to visitors who are hungry, often neighbors who are homeless and staying in shelters or camps by The Basilica. Opportunity Center MealBasilica volunteers pick up food and prepare and serve a hot meal for 200-250 people on the second and fourth Saturdays each month at Catholic Charities Opportunity Center (formerly Branch III) on the corner of 17th and Chicago Avenue in Minneapolis. |
